Partilhar via


Cenário de informações do PwrTest

O PwrTest Info Scenario captura e registra as informações atuais de energia do sistema de várias categorias.

Sintaxe

pwrtest /info:option [/p:{n|a|*}] [/w:n]  [/?] 

/info:option

opção Descrição

Todos

Exibe todas as informações do sistema.

powercap

Exibe SYSTEM_POWER_CAPABILITIES.

powerinfo

Exibe SYSTEM_POWER_CAPABILITIES.

Bateria

Exibe SYSTEM_BATTERY_STATE.

Ppm

Exibe todas as informações do processador.

ppmidle

Exibe informações de estado ocioso do processador.

ppmperf

Exibe informações de estado de desempenho do processador.

ppmperfverbose

Exibe informações de estado de desempenho do processador no formato detalhado .

/p:{n|a|\*}

Especifica o número do processador lógico para as opções /info:ppm/info:ppmidle ou /info:ppmperf .

a ou \*
Especifica todos os processadores lógicos (padrão).

/w:{y|n}
Especifica o tempo em segundos para aguardar o evento de rundown do PPM (o padrão é 10 segundos).

Exemplos

pwrtest /info:all
  pwrtest /info:battery
  pwrtest /info:ppm
  pwrtest /info:ppm /p:1
 pwrtest /info:ppmidle
  pwrtest /info:ppmperf /p:2

Saída do arquivo de log XML

<PwrTestLog>
  <SystemInformation>
  </SystemInformation>
  <InfoScenario>
    <SYSTEM_POWER_CAPABILITIES> 
      <SystemS1StateSupported></SystemS1StateSupported>
      <SystemS2StateSupported></SystemS2StateSupported>
      <SystemS3StateSupported></SystemS3StateSupported>
      <SystemS4StateSupported></SystemS4StateSupported>
      <SystemS5StateSupported></SystemS5StateSupported>
      <RtcWakeSupported></RtcWakeSupported>
      <FastSystemS4></FastSystemS4>
    </SYSTEM_POWER_CAPABILITIES> 
    <SYSTEM_POWER_INFORMATION> 
      <MaxIdlenessAllowed></MaxIdlenessAllowed>
      <Idleness></Idleness>
      <TimeRemaining></TimeRemaining>
      <CoolingMode></CoolingMode>
    </SYSTEM_POWER_INFORMATION> 
    <SYSTEM_BATTERY_STATE> 
      <AcOnLine></AcOnLine>
      <BatteryPresent></BatteryPresent>
      <Charging></Charging>
      <Discharging></Discharging>
      <MaxCapacity></MaxCapacity>
      <RemainingCapacity></RemainingCapacity>
      <RateOfDrain></RateOfDrain>
      <EstimatedTime></EstimatedTime>
      <DefaultAlert1></DefaultAlert1>
      <DefaultAlert2></DefaultAlert2>
    </SYSTEM_BATTERY_STATE> 
    <PROCESSOR_POWER_INFORMATION> 
      <CPUNumber></CPUNumber>
      <MaxMhz></MaxMhz>
      <CurrentMhz></CurrentMhz>
      <MhzLimit></MhzLimit>
      <MaxIdleState></MaxIdleState>
      <CurrentIdleState></CurrentIdleState>
    </PROCESSOR_POWER_INFORMATION> 
    </InfoScenario>
</PwrTestLog> 

A tabela a seguir descreve os elementos XML que aparecem no arquivo de log.

Elemento Descrição
<InfoScenario>

Contém informações relacionadas ao cenário de informações. Há apenas um <elemento InfoScenario> em um arquivo de log PwrTest.

<SYSTEM_POWER_CAPABILITIES>

Contém informações relacionadas aos recursos de energia do sistema. Essas informações são recuperadas da estrutura SYSTEM_POWER_CAPABILITIES.

<SystemSxStateSupported>

Indica se um determinado estado de suspensão acpi do sistema tem suporte no sistema.

<RtcWakeSupported>

Indica o estado de suspensão mais baixo em que há suporte para a ativação do RTC (ativar no temporizador). O valor é da enumeração SYSTEM_POWER_STATE.

<FastSystemS4>

Indica se a suspensão híbrida está disponível no sistema.

<SYSTEM_POWER_INFORMATION>

Contém informações relacionadas à ociosidade do sistema.

<MaxIdlenessAllowed>

Indica a ociosidade (em porcentagem) quando o sistema é considerado ocioso e o tempo limite ocioso começa a contar.

<Ociosidade>

Nível ocioso atual, expresso em porcentagem.

<TimeRemaining>

Indica o tempo restante no temporizador ocioso em espera do sistema, em segundos.

<CoolingMode>

Indica o modo de resfriamento do sistema atual: (0) Ativo, (1), Passivo, (2) Inválido.

<SYSTEM_BATTERY_STATE>

Contém informações relacionadas ao estado atual da bateria do sistema.

<AcOnLine>

Indica se o sistema está operando atualmente na energia AC.

<BatteryPresent>

Indica se pelo menos uma bateria está presente no sistema.

<Carregamento>

Indica se pelo menos uma bateria está carregando no momento.

<Descarga>

Indica se pelo menos uma bateria está sendo descarregada no momento.

<Maxcapacity>

Capacidade máxima da bateria quando nova, em miliwatts horas (mW-h).

<RemainingCapacity>

Capacidade restante estimada da bateria, em miliwatts horas (mW-h).

<RateOfDrain>

Indica a taxa atual de descarga da bateria em miliwatts (mW).

<EstimatedTime>

Tempo estimado restante na bateria, em segundos.

<DefaultAlert1>

Indica a capacidade sugerida pelo fabricante da bateria quando um alerta de bateria baixa deve ocorrer.

<DefaultAlert2>

Indica a capacidade sugerida pelo fabricante da bateria quando um alerta de bateria de aviso deve ocorrer.

<PROCESSOR_POWER_INFORMATION>

Contém informações relacionadas aos processadores do sistema e seus recursos de gerenciamento de energia.

<CPUNumber>

Indica qual processador o elemento de PROCESSOR_POWER_INFORMATION> atual <está descrevendo.

<MaxMhz>

Indica a frequência máxima do processador.

<CurrentMhz>

Indica a frequência atual do processador.

<MhzLimit>

Indica o limite atual na frequência do relógio do processador.

<MaxIdleState>

Indica o estado ocioso máximo do processador.

<CurrentIdleState>

Indica o estado ocioso atual do processador.

Sintaxe pwrTest